What Are Ordinals?
The primary Ordinals inscription was added to Bitcoin in December 2022, and began to realize traction in early 2023. An ordinal consists of two elements: a person satoshi (the smallest unit of bitcoin), and an inscription. Every satoshi is recognized by the order wherein it was created within the Bitcoin protocol, and the Ordinals protocol tracks every satoshi as they’re transferred between wallets.
The inscription is information that’s written (or inscribed) on the Bitcoin blockchain and is related to a person (“marked”) satoshi on the time of the inscription. This enables individuals to inscribe information on Bitcoin, and assign and switch possession of that on-chain information or inscription utilizing the “marked” satoshi.
The primary ordinal created is numbered “ordinal 0” and every subsequent ordinal increments the counter by one. All ordinals type a single ordinals NFT assortment. There was an preliminary rush to create the lowest-numbered ordinals, motivated by the collectibility of very low ordinal numbers. The worth of those early ordinals was largely within the low ordinal quantity, and the precise information inscribed was not as vital (many had been simply copy-pasted pictures of current works, typically finished with out permission from the unique creators).
In different phrases: An ordinal is sort of a digital postage stamp, and the protocol permits anybody to print their very own stamps. Identical to with actual, bodily stamps, these digital stamps are belongings that may be owned, bought and transferred. The stamp or ordinal has the benefit of being digital, saved and secured on the Bitcoin blockchain. Each Bitcoin and Ordinals are open, permissionless protocols, so anybody can use Ordinals to print no matter stamps they need.
In the previous few weeks, we’ve got seen over 750,000 “stamps” printed on Bitcoin. And, similar to with bodily stamps, some are value greater than others. Certainly one of Yuga Labs’ “stamps” bought for greater than 7 BTC, value over $150,000 on the time.
Why Ordinals Are Good For Bitcoin
The most important criticism of ordinals is that storing further digital belongings on Bitcoin means extra block house should be used to retailer these digital belongings. Every year, the Bitcoin blockchain can solely retailer a bit over 200 gigabytes of knowledge as its theoretical most (as every Bitcoin block has a theoretical most measurement of 4 megabytes, with miners including one block roughly each 10 minutes, and thus, roughly 210 gigabytes’ value of knowledge per 12 months), which incorporates all common bitcoin transactions along with marked satoshis and the accompanying inscription information.
Storing ordinals can simply deplete much more block house than regulator transactions do, crowding out these common transactions and driving up transaction charges. However this isn’t unhealthy. Charges going up point out demand for and use of Bitcoin, and that cash goes straight to the bitcoin miners who safe the blockchain. That incentivizes extra miners and nodes to affix, additional strengthening the blockchain. Critics additionally overlook that bitcoin is a real free market. Increased charges ought to imply that the ordinals being written to Bitcoin are of upper worth than common transactions are, simply by the character of their existence. In the event that they aren’t, they received’t promote and received’t be created.
I do agree with critics who level out that a lot of the NFT collections going to Bitcoin are losing house — of their rush to be fashionable, they’re bloating the blockchain with transactions that I don’t see as actually beneficial. Once I inscribed a ten,000-image assortment of ordinals, our staff determined to deliberately use solely 20 kilobytes of Bitcoin blockchain information whole, thus minimizing disruption of the remainder of the mempool. Consideration of block house ought to be an ordinary for any NFT assortment launching on Bitcoin.
Ordinals Does Want a Normal
The Ethereum NFT market had a number of years to develop — on the time of writing, two of the highest three most-used functions on Ethereum (by the quantity of gasoline paid) are NFT marketplaces (on Etherscan, as Blur and OpenSea’s Seaport). Bitcoin is the most important blockchain by market cap, so it stands to cause that there will probably be a Bitcoin NFT market (or a number of) quickly. Nevertheless, the place Ethereum obtained it proper was in its NFT requirements, and that’s what Bitcoin NFTs are nonetheless lacking.
As talked about earlier, all ordinals are a part of a single NFT assortment on Bitcoin. One vital NFT customary out there on Ethereum, and never but on Bitcoin, is the power for a selected creator to outline a customized NFT assortment of simply their NFTs. The NFT assortment customary is vitally vital for provenance, safety, interoperability and progress. On Ethereum, there are various NFT explorers, wallets and marketplaces, and so they can all interoperate and perceive which assortment any NFT belongs to.
This searchability doesn’t exist for ordinals on Bitcoin but. To be honest, ordinals are model new. Ethereum had a number of years to develop NFT requirements, reminiscent of ERC-721 and ERC-1155. However now that Bitcoin NFTs are right here, we have to create these requirements as quickly as attainable.
Ordinals, the protocol, can be not a completed product. In actual fact, it’s nonetheless very a lot an alpha launch. The protocol is being actively developed and upcoming updates will give it extra energy and make it extra environment friendly.
One vital upcoming characteristic is “collections and provenance.” This can enable creators to obviously authenticate {that a} group of ordinals are a part of the identical assortment. The method used to allow this characteristic is in itself a strong characteristic: the power for an ordinal to reference one other ordinal. The gathering provenance is established by having a mother or father assortment ordinal that’s referenced by its many youngsters ordinals which might be all members of the gathering. This has two important benefits: provenance for the gathering could be very clear, and cupboard space required to retailer all the information for the kid ordinals may be drastically lowered by reusing information within the mother or father.
That is what we did with our ordinal inscription: you may see what assortment provenance appears to be like like for your self in Ordinal inscription 20219. This customary will enhance safety and provenance for everybody, and we’d like that to maintain individuals from being scammed. Proper now, creators are passing round ad-hoc lists of ordinals that they are saying are “a group.” As a result of marketplaces and explorers solely get a few of this metadata, they’ve a tough time verifying the provenance of those lists.
If we will get an ordinary arrange and working, it will possibly at all times be improved. Within the interim, it should give the groups constructing Bitcoin NFT DApps (like wallets and explorers) the infrastructure they want.
